Incline hammer curls work well for bi's and forearms too.
 
Try doing this:
1. incline DB curls: 3x8
2. BB curls: 3x6
3. preacher curls: 3x8
4. hammer curls: 3x10
5. reverse BB wrist curls: 3x15

The incline DB curls will stretch out your bi's, which will pre-fatigue them for the BB curls. After BB curls, the preachers will stretch the bi's again, but in a different position. The DB's are at your side when doing the inclines, and in front of your torso when you are doing preacher curls. These three exercises will hit all motions for training biceps. The hammer curls will hit both your bi's and forearms, plus doing them heavy will help your bench also. Finish off with reverse BB wrist curls to hit the top side of your forearms that can easily be neglected. Good luck. :chomp:
